Apr 27, 2020 04:37:33 AM Edited Apr 27, 2020 04:41:00 AM by Preston H
re: "I have read it takes screenshots every 3 minutes"
Time Doctor may indeed do that.
Upwork has no control over how Time Doctor works.
An Upwork client may ask a freelancer to use Time Doctor. An Upwork freelancer is not required to do so, however.
If a client asks me to use Time Doctor then I may say:
"No thank you. I don't do that. I wish you well in finding a freelancer who meets your needs for this project."
Or
"Yes, I will be happy to use Time Doctor while I work on your project."
Or
"I would like to work on your project, but I would only do so while using the Upwork time-tracker instead of Time Doctor. If that works for you, then I will accept the contract."
